Falelalaga Limited is a New Zealand-based company dedicated to preserving and promoting traditional Pacific Island craftsmanship. Specialising in handcrafted products made from natural and sustainable materials, Falelalaga supports local artisans while fostering cultural heritage. Their unique range of homeware, decor, and accessories reflects the rich artistry of the Pacific, offering customers beautiful, eco-friendly creations with a meaningful story behind every piece.

Our Story

We engage with local growers and weavers in the village and we source out the raw product.

We weave physical and spiritual connections between Samoan people and their identity, culture, history and heritage. We engage with local growers and weavers in the village and we source out the products: bandanas, handicrafts. We distribute our products through local community engagement, businesses, individuals and potential partners. We expose learners to real-life learning through active participation in weaving workshops and language classes. We facilitate therapeutic weaving retreat to connect to the body, mind and soul.
